start at 60% comm
each person I recruit bumps 5%
at 110% i'm vested and get 0.10% of TOTAL premiums written by company.

This offer stands for anyone else I bring in as well. If you bring in the people and get to 110%....you are vested as well.

I understand I could get 80%-100% ... but if I bust my rear to recruit good people...in a few years I think it's reasonable to think I could get to 110% AND get 0.10% of company's writings...this year that would be 30K a y ear extra.....plus I would be making 110% on what I sold. That 30K is bound to increase in the next few years.

30+ carriers
life ins
annuity
mortgage
FE

Ever consider that you can get 110%+ now, immediate vesting and have the freedom to recruit if you want to but not require to do so. With production, there are 125%+ contracts out there.

What you are leaving on the table during the time you try to build from 60% to 110% would take many years to recover once you topped out with that outfit.

Just realize that recruiting is a full-time job and by the time you get 10 2 will fall off you'll add one more you lose three you add two so you'll be pretty much recruiting 100% of the time

The problem with recruiting as it doesn't make you any money. Until the recruits sell something. And then you're just making a percentage of what they sold. You would be better off spending the next two years building up a good book of business for yourself and then recruit. By that time though you will have enough confidence to go out on your own.
